The year 1855 in archaeology involved some significant events.

Excavations

  • May - Heath Wood barrow cemetery in England, by Thomas Bateman.[1]

Events

  • December 14 - inaugural meeting of the London and Middlesex Archaeological Society

Publications

  • John Yonge Akerman - Remains of Pagan Saxondom.
  • Churchill Babington (ed.) - Benefizio della Morte di Cristo, a remarkable book of the Reformation period.

Births

  • September 10 - Robert Koldewey, German archaeologist (d. 1925).[2]

Deaths

  • April 15 - William John Bankes, English Member of Parliament, explorer and Egyptologist (b. 1786).[3]
